We analyzed 22 examples of how Notion handles ai input & output across their product, spanning 4 different approaches: entry point, input composition, input modifier, context indicator.

Personalization modal for Notion AI allowing avatar selection, naming, and custom instructions via a linked page.

Notion AI home/landing state with personalized greeting, input field, mode tabs (Auto/Research/All sources), app connector banner, and starter prompt cards.

Notion AI home state with different personalized avatar/greeting. Same input field, mode tabs, connector banner, and starter prompts as 3102.

Text selection floating toolbar on a page with 'Improve writing' and 'Ask AI' entry points alongside standard formatting controls (Comment, Text, Bold, Italic, etc.).

Side panel AI chat on a new page. Shows personalized greeting, starter prompts, input field with mode tabs, and bottom 'Get started with' bar. Panel header shows 'New AI chat' dropdown.

Inline AI on a page showing completed proofread result with follow-up input field and action menu (Insert below, Try again, Close, Get Notion AI). Context scoped to 'Current page'.

Inline AI on a page showing completed edit with strikethrough diff, follow-up input field, and action menu including Accept and Discard. Context scoped to 'Current page'.

Inline AI on a page with input field open and a suggested actions dropdown. Shows Suggested section (Improve writing, Proofread, Translate to) and Edit section (Make shorter, Change tone, Simplify language, Make longer, Edit selection...). Context scoped to 'Current page'.

New page AI prompt for drafting. Shows AI instruction text and user-typed prompt. Context scoped to 'Current page'.

Completed AI draft on new page with action menu showing Accept, Discard, Insert below, Try again, Get Notion AI. Follow-up input field with 'Current page' context scope.

Side panel AI chat with 'All sources' dropdown expanded, showing source filter options including Web search, Apps and integrations, All sources I can access, workspace name, Help Center, and Connect apps. Also shows user has typed text in the input field.

Side panel AI chat showing completed AI response with follow-up input field, action icons (copy, add to page, thumbs up, feedback), and 'New page' chip. The conversation is titled 'Definition of design systems'. The input field has placeholder and mode tabs.

Side panel AI chat open alongside the 'Definition of design systems' page. Chat shows completed response and follow-up input with page context chip. Auto-attached page context shown as 'Definition of design syste...' chip in input area.

AI block configuration panel on a page. Shows Generate dropdown (with options: Custom output, Page summary, Key points), a prompt text area, and Using/Search context controls. 'Key points' is currently selected. Context set to 'Current page only'.

AI block configuration panel set to 'Custom output' mode with a user-typed prompt referencing a @-mentioned page. Context section shows 'Specified context' with the page chip, and Search section shows 'Don't search any sources'.

Inline AI on a new page showing AI block output with citations, a follow-up input field with 'All sources' context scope, and an action menu (Insert below, Try again, Close, Get Notion AI).

Inline AI on a new page with an AI block generating content. Shows 'Generating...' button on the block and the AI avatar in the bottom-right. Page content above is already written.

Inline AI on a new empty page with input field and suggested actions dropdown. Shows Suggested section (Draft anything..., Draft an outline..., Make a table..., Make a flowchart...), Write section (Write anything...), and Think, ask, chat section (Brainstorm ideas..., Get help with code... partially visible). Context scoped to 'Current page'.

Inline AI on a new page showing user prompt with @-mentioned page reference. AI instruction text visible above. Context scoped to 'All sources'.

Inline AI on a page showing 'Reading page' loading state with animated dots indicator while processing the current page content.

AI is actively editing a new page, showing 'Editing' loading state with animated dots. Draft Document heading and Introduction subheading are being generated.

Inline AI on a new page showing 'Thinking' loading state with animated dots indicator while processing the prompt.